Experimental Study of Nitrate Absorption Isotherms Determination on Latium Composite Overactive Carbon

Journal Title: International Journal of new Chemistry - Year 2015, Vol 2, Issue 4

Abstract

The aim of this study is to verify the amount of nitrate absorption on Latium composite over active carbon in which pH parameters, temperature, pollutant concentration, contact time for absorbent were considered. It was determined that optimum condition for absorbent are pH=3, T= 0 ˚C and initial concentration of solution=10 ppm, then absorption parameters verified and after drawing absorption isotherms (Langmuir, freundlich) in nitrate absorption process it was evident that languir model had the most conformity with experimental data gained Latium composite on active carbon
